Output 987621160df3c484c54020159b91c625d30b14e77b2e384e2625bfa51166efd6:15

value
46252832
script pubkey
OP_0 OP_PUSHBYTES_32 ea4c688550e23a96c64743fbef4f395e57831a23223f10883e374c17164689a8
address
bc1qafxx3p2sugafd3j8g0a77neetetcxx3rygl3pzp7xaxpw9jx3x5q2ffdqf
transaction
987621160df3c484c54020159b91c625d30b14e77b2e384e2625bfa51166efd6